How many restaurant tickets can be used by cashiers?

Since October 2022, the regulation no longer sets national restrictions on thenumberRestaurant tickets can be used at once, whether in cash or with a dematerialised card. The only criterion that now counts is theceiling of 25 € maximum per day per person, applicable to all formats – paper as a map – and for all food businesses up to31 December 2026(seeOpeneat source).
In concrete terms, it is possible to pay with 2 tickets of 12 €, 3 of 8 € or 5 tickets of 5 €, where the total meets the threshold of 25 €. However, some brands sometimes set their own limits (« maximum 3 tickets per pass »(e.g.), marked at the entrance or in the box. This flexibility replaces the old rule which limited two tickets, often considered penalising. Many find that the real risk of blockage usually comes from the internal rules of some supermarkets, not from legislation.
To be noted:no official limit on the number of securities used, butdaily ceiling of 25 €per person remains unavoidable.
Legal ceiling – which texts apply?
The current regulations are based on articles L3262-1 to L3262-5 of theLabour Codeand the press releasesrecent CNTR(National Commission of Titles-Restaurant). The fixed amount of 25 € by passage exists since the1 October 2022for all beneficiary employees, and its application is guaranteed until the end of 2026.
- Daily ceiling of 25 €for all, paper and dematerialised
- NoCurrency returnwith paper tickets: better to anticipate,
- Dematerialized map: exact debited amount, automatic compliance with ceiling

Why do some traders limit the number of tickets?
Less known detail: even if the national rule does not impose anything, each store or restaurant can,for its own logistical or IT constraintssetting internal limits. We are sometimes surprised by the display « max 2 tickets/purchase »... While no law provides for this practice! Some distribution professionals believe that these thresholds are also used to smooth lines, limit commissions, or simplify cash flow.
- In the large distribution (Leclerc, Carrefour, Auchan...), there are commonly limits to the2 or 3 tickets per pass
- Independent restaurants tend to keep to the legal ceiling: therefore, use is more flexible on the number
- Organic stores, caterers, specialized points: varying restrictions depending on influence, equipment or choice of manager
In practice, the merchant chooses the rules that suit him, it is not always felt as "just". Several clients report that thedematerialised mapoffers more tranquility: the ceiling is managed on its own and there is no risk of error related to the number of paper coupons to be scanned.
What to do in case of refusal or internal limitation?
No need to worry if a sign refuses to accept more tickets than expected. There are several options:
- Request a mixed payment: tickets and credit card or cash for the rest (practice in large purchases)
- Make several successive purchases: but beware, thedaily ceilingdo not change, no need to try to bypass it
- Take a picture of the display to support a possible complaint: some consumers have already settled disputes as well
Moreover, the majority of cash refusals are related to a lack of information on the market side (not a desire to block). One trainer said that, very often, it is enough to ask the right question or to exchange a few words with the cashier to make the situation calm.

How to allocate the ceiling of 25 € Depending on the value of the tickets?
It is possible to rely on a few concrete examples to optimize the use of its restaurant titles. Some choose to accumulate small amounts to stick to the ceiling without losing a cent. Typical combinations include:
- 3 tickets to 8 €Total 24 €
- 2 tickets at 12,10 €Total 24.20 €
- 5 tickets to 5 €Total 25 €
- 2 tickets to 10 € + 1 to 5 €Total 25 €
Good to know: with the card, if the last ticket exceeds the ceiling, the terminal blocks the transaction or invites you to complete with a credit card – no cent is lost. Moreover, it sometimes happens that a cashier spontaneously proposes this option: to avoid many upsets.
Mixed payment: tickets and card, how to do it?
When the amount of the races exceeds25 €, or as soon as non-food items are included, do not hesitate to pay the eligible amount with tickets (up to 25 €), then complete with your credit card or cash for the difference. This operation is validated by the regulations (sources: CNTR and USSRAF), and accepted in more than220,000 affiliated outletsin France.

Concrete example: two-step payment
Imagine a basket of38,60 €in supermarkets, of which 28 € of foodstuffs. You can use:2 tickets of 12,10 €(24.20) € for the eligible party), then settle the rest (14,40 €) by credit card. FAQ: Limitations, refusals and good practices
- Legal limit on the number of tickets:No, it's only theceiling of 25 €/daythat counts.
- Merchant limiting to 2 or 3 tickets?Right reserved to store: Always check the display, and complete with the credit card if necessary.
- Value of a ticket:by employer, generally between8 €and14,52 €, regularly12,10 €for the most common titles.
- Online Regulation:may be used subject to the use of the partner mobile card or app (logo Ticket Restaurant to follow).
- Restaurant/supermarket differences :The ceiling applies everywhere, but supermarkets can add internal limits while in restoration, flexibility remains more frequent.
Note: Split use (passing the caisse several times in the same store and on the same day) remains prohibited. In the event of repeated abuse or refusal, the CNTR or a mediator may intervene and provide an official reply under15 days.
Good reflexes to avoid blockage in case
Ensuring a fluid experience requires a little preparation. Several experts recommend these steps:
- Identify signs indicating the ceiling or number of tickets allowed in the trade
- Prior separation of food products from non-food products to save time
- First present tickets or card, then complete in CB depending on remaining balance
- In case of doubt, question the cashier politely... A benevolent word regularly unlocks the situation
